ACEI Standing Committees are Membership, Nominations, Publications, Teacher Educators: Professional Standards and NCATE, Public Affairs, and Awards. The Standing Committee Chairs are selected and appointed by the Executive Board. Standing Committee members serve 3-year terms.

ACEI Program Committees are International Outreach, Infancy/ Early Childhood, Intermediate/ Middle Childhood, Heritage, Research, Technology, and Diversity. The Program Committee Chairs are elected by Committee members. Program Committee members serve 2-year terms.

Standing Committees

Awards

Responsible for evaluating new award proposals; keeps ACEI' s award program current with the needs of the membership; develops award guidelines and selection criteria; drafts appropriate application or nomination forms; select the winner(s) in each category and submits the name(s) to the Executive Board for final approval; assists Headquarters with efforts to promote ACEI's Awards Program. Members of the Awards Committee are ineligible to receive an award and they must wait at least one year after serving on the committee to be considered for an award.
